public abstract class AbstractAnnotationTagProposal {
/**
* A class to simplify tracking a reference position in a document.
*/
static final class ReferenceTracker {
/** The reference position category name. */
private static final String CATEGORY= "reference_position"; //$NON-NLS-1$
/** The position updater of the reference position. */
private final IPositionUpdater fPositionUpdater= new DefaultPositionUpdater(CATEGORY);
/** The reference position. */
private final Position fPosition= new Position(0);
/**
* Called before document changes occur. It must be followed by a call to postReplace().
*
* @param document the document on which to track the reference position.
*
*/
public void preReplace(IDocument document, int offset) throws BadLocationException {
fPosition.setOffset(offset);
try {
document.addPositionCategory(CATEGORY);
document.addPositionUpdater(fPositionUpdater);
document.addPosition(CATEGORY, fPosition);
} catch (BadPositionCategoryException e) {
// should not happen
e.printStackTrace();
}
}
/**
* Called after the document changed occurred. It must be preceded by a call to preReplace().
*
* @param document the document on which to track the reference position.
*/
public int postReplace(IDocument document) {
try {
document.removePosition(CATEGORY, fPosition);
document.removePositionUpdater(fPositionUpdater);
document.removePositionCategory(CATEGORY);
} catch (BadPositionCategoryException e) {
// should not happen
e.printStackTrace();
}
return fPosition.getOffset();
}
}

/**
* Checks whether <code>prefix</code> is a valid prefix for this proposal. Usually, while code
* completion is in progress, the user types and edits the prefix in the document in order to
* filter the proposal list. From {@link #validate(IDocument, int, DocumentEvent) }, the
* current prefix in the document is extracted and this method is called to find out whether the
* proposal is still valid.
* <p>
* The default implementation checks if <code>prefix</code> is a prefix of the proposal's
* {@link #getDisplayString() display string} using the {@link #isPrefix(String, String) }
* method.
* </p>
*
* @param prefix the current prefix in the document
* @return <code>true</code> if <code>prefix</code> is a valid prefix of this proposal
*/
protected boolean isValidPrefix(String prefix) {
/*
* See http://dev.eclipse.org/bugs/show_bug.cgi?id=17667
* why we do not use the replacement string.
* String word= fReplacementString;
*/
return isPrefix(prefix, getDisplayString());
}

/**
* Matches <code>prefix</code> against <code>string</code> and replaces the matched region
* by prefix. Case is preserved as much as possible. This method returns <code>string</code> if camel case completion
* is disabled. Examples when camel case completion is enabled:
* <ul>
* <li>getCamelCompound("NuPo", "NullPointerException") -> "NuPointerException"</li>
* <li>getCamelCompound("NuPoE", "NullPointerException") -> "NuPoException"</li>
* <li>getCamelCompound("hasCod", "hashCode") -> "hasCode"</li>
* </ul>
*
* @param prefix the prefix to match against
* @param string the string to match
* @return a compound of prefix and any postfix taken from <code>string</code>
* @since 3.2
*/
protected final String getCamelCaseCompound(String prefix, String string) {
if (prefix.length() > string.length())
return string;
// a normal prefix - no camel case logic at all
String start= string.substring(0, prefix.length());
if (start.equalsIgnoreCase(prefix))
return string;
final char[] patternChars= prefix.toCharArray();
final char[] stringChars= string.toCharArray();
for (int i= 1; i <= stringChars.length; i++)
if (CharOperation.camelCaseMatch(patternChars, 0, patternChars.length, stringChars, 0, i))
return prefix + string.substring(i);
// Not a camel case match at all.
// This should not happen -> stay with the default behavior
return string;
}
